Maintenance

19

Chisels and bits should be kept sharp for best  
performance, a discoloured tip is usually a sign of  
excessive heat caused by a blunt auger and/or chisel. 
 
Bits are best sharpened with a small file and chisels 
with the special mortice chisel sharpeners, see our  
catalogue or visit our website at axminster.co.uk
 
Burrs can be removed from the sides of the chisel on a 
fine oilstone or waterstone but great care must be taken 
not to taper the chisel as this will cause the chisel to jam 
in the timber.

Chisel Abrasion

Look into the hollow of the chisel and check around the 
corners for signs of dulled or rounded corners, see fig 37. 
If there are any deviations in the chisel we recommend 
using the multi- flute conical reamer sharpening set, code 
700173 with the appropriate size pilot piece, just a few 
turns removes a tiny amount of metal from the chisel’s 
internal bevel.  
 
When abrasion occurs to the extent that the chisel bit tip 
becomes thin and liable to break, it is advisable to replace 
it with a new one.

Sharpening Chisel Auger Bit

A well sharpened auger bit will cut more efficiently,  
passing easily through the twist and being ejected 
through the slot in the side of the chisel.  Sharpen the 
spur on the auger bit using a small square or flat file and 
sharpen the inside only, see figs 37-38.

WARNING!! DO NOT SHARPEN, STONE OR GRIND 
THE BIT ON THE OUTSIDE WHICH WILL REDUCE 
ITS DIAMETER CAUSING WOOD SHAVINGS TO 
BUILD UP INSIDE THE CHISEL!
